Output d1ae396d83cd602a09e7d6ee2a61a6a2e18fba7e842a95cd81568d751fd30d0a:1

value
686976
script pubkey
OP_0 OP_PUSHBYTES_20 2b50b3e2f8194308b3e8b96a920dbb118516cacc
address
bc1q9dgt8chcr9ps3vlgh94fyrdmzxz3djkvan7x7e
transaction
d1ae396d83cd602a09e7d6ee2a61a6a2e18fba7e842a95cd81568d751fd30d0a